Hajipara HWC: First in northeast to receive NAQS certification

DISPUR, Assam: The Hajipara Health and Wellness Centre, situated in the Barpeta District of Assam, has become the first centre in northeastern region that has been awarded the ‘quality certification’ under the National Quality Assurance Standards (NAQS) programme.

The Hajipara Health & Wellness Centre has managed to score 89 per cent in the assessment and met six criteria required to attain the National Quality Certification.

The centre was established in the year 1993 and was assessed for seven services in the state of Assam. Later it has also undergone the external assessment done by the empanelled external assessors on May 4, 2022. The HWC has also gone through assessment by Pranjal Das, then Community Health Officer.

The centre incorporates neonatal and infant health care services, childhood and adolescent health care services, family planning, contraceptive services and other reproductive health care services, pregnancy care and childbirth, management of communicable diseases including national health programmes, screening, prevention, control and management of non-communicable diseases, management of common communicable diseases and outpatient care for acute simple illnesses and minor ailments, health promotion and wellness activities (including yoga) and the teleconsultation service.

A Health & Wellness Centre has five ASHA workers and eight Anganwadi Workers. The centre caters to a total population of 6466 people in the region.
